(PatriotNewsDaily.com) – Rep. Dean Phillips from Minnesota who has launched a long-shot presidential campaign against President Joe Biden in the 2024 Democratic presidential primary recently issued an apology to Vice President Kamala Harris after he had made comments criticizing her.

In an interview with the Atlantic that was released on Tuesday, Phillips had noted that he had heard from other Democrats that Harris might not be the best option if President Biden is unable to continue serving. However, this comment could have potentially hurt his chances with Democratic voters. As part of his remarks, Phillips also pointed out that he had not personally seen the “deficiencies” others had in Harris and that he was only repeating what he had been told by others.

Phillips continued by arguing that others who are more familiar with the Vice President had told him that she was not positioned well and was unprepared. He added that others have also criticized Harris for not having the best disposition and competencies to run the Presidential office.

Following the release of the interview, Phillips posted on Wednesday an apology on X, formerly known as Twitter in which he argued that he should not have referenced the opinions that others have shared with him.

He added that he owes the Vice President an apology as the things he shared do not represent his opinion of her and that he had a lot of respect for Harris. He noted that he owns his mistake and that he was apologizing not only to Harris but also to anyone else who has faced similar circumstances.
